The workshop’s goal is to take a sketch or finished pencil
drawing and use inking techniques to make the image ready for print, or just to
make the drawing look more polished.
Examples from professional artists will be analyzed, and students will
have the opportunity to ink prepared drawings, so they will leave the classes
with new, finished work.

Class 1: Techniques involving tech pens and quills will be covered. Shading and texture will be the primary focus.
Class 2: Techniques involving brushes will be introduced, and incorporating pens and quills into those techniques will be encouraged. Other tools and techniques will also be touched on, such as inkwash, splatter effects, and the use of secondary inking tools like toothbrushes, white-out, sponges and paper towels will be covered too.
Ted is a comic book artist based in Ypsilanti, Michigan. He self-publishes his own comic ‘The Book of Love’, and does freelance work for the companies such as Cryptozoic, Shot in the Dark Comics, and Fubar. He graduated with a BFA in Sequential Art from Savannah College of Art & Design and sells his books and artwork at comic conventions across the country.
